Originally from San Diego, Beth graduated from UC Berkeley with a degree in Rhetoric (yes, that is actually a major). She spent 8 years at PacifiCare Health Systems in sales management for Secure Horizons, one of California’s first Medicare Advantage plans. She was part of the team that expanded Secure Horizons throughout the Bay Area, Sacramento and the Central Valley.
In 2000, Beth became a licensed financial advisor to work alongside her husband Jim at Smith Barney until she retired from corporate life to be a full-time mom and active community volunteer.
Realizing the incredible need to help people navigate the Medicare maze, Beth came out of retirement to launch the Medicare Solutions division of Gebhardt Group Inc., an independent financial planning wealth management firm.
She and Jim live in Lafayette, CA and have four children ranging in age from 21 to 14. She is an aspiring guitarist who enjoys baking, hiking, yoga and 80’s music.
